    Openvix 5 4 013 Release Vuduo2 Usb Not installing.

    Hi all and thanks for reading.
    I have acquired second hand vu duo2 STB. it came with openPLi installed on it. Though this works well I would like to use openvix. I downloaded the relevant zipped file, extracted it, and placed the files on a USB stick. I switched off the STB placed the USB stick in the receptacle behind the front panel. I then switched on the STB at the rear. I waited for the prompt to press the power button behind the panel on the front. There was no prompt. However, the LED on the USB stick was flickering, so I assumed the STB was reading and collecting the data from the USB stick. On examination it would appear that no installation has taken place. I've repeated this process with two other USB sticks and placed these memory sticks at the rear and the front of the STB without success, what am I doing wrong?

    Its important that the usb stick is formatted to FAT 32 and the files are extracted direct to usb so that they are in the correct order. Make sure no other sticks plugged in. If you dont get prompt press pwoer in front at same time as back but correct file layout could be the porblem.

    You can also flash the Vix image from within PLI. Place the zipped image file on the root of the HDD (i.e not in a folder). In the "Flash Image" menu, you will see image in the downloaded category.
